Hazel Clark Phillips, 89, of Coal Valley, died Friday, November 23, 2018, at home. Visitation will be at 1:00 p.m., Wednesday, November 28, 2018 at Kirk, Huggins, & Esterdahl in Orion. The funeral will follow visitation at 2:00 at the funeral home.

Burial will be at Western Township Cemetery. Memorials may be made to Rock Island County Humane Society. Hazel was born on October 31, 1929 in Des Moines, IA.

She married Herbert Jones, and together they had 4 children. She then married Wilbur Clark and together they had 2 children. Hazel then married Charles Phillips.

She was an assembly operator at Montgomery Elevator for 14 years. She was a member of Free Will Baptist Church in Colona. She especially loved being with her family and celebrating holidays.

Survivors include her children, Rodney (Kris) Jones, Bellevue, IL, Ella Schaeffer, Coal Valley, Judy (Jason) Strenski, Melbourne, FL, Dennis Jones, Virginia Beach, VA, Lynn (Ed) Martin, Orion, and Daniel (Liz) Clark, Fulton, IL; her loving step-children; 17 grandchildren; 25 great grandchildren; and 5 great great grandchildren.
